Juventus Beats Cagliari 4-0 to Reach Coppa Italia Quarter-Finals

By  Milcah   Tanimu

Juventus secured a dominant 4-0 victory over Cagliari in the Coppa Italia Round of 16 at Allianz Stadium, advancing to the quarter-finals. The Serie A giants will face Empoli in the next round after a stellar performance on Monday.

Match Highlights: Juventus’ Dominance in Coppa Italia

The match began with Juventus taking control early, with **Dusan Vlahovic** scoring in the 43rd minute. Vlahovic latched onto a precise through ball from **Arda Yildiz**, breaking the deadlock just before halftime.

In the second half, **Teun Koopmeiners** doubled the lead with a stunning free-kick in the 50th minute, leaving Cagliari goalkeeper **Andrea D’Alessandro** helpless.

**Francisco Conceição** added a third in the 75th minute, capitalizing on a brilliant assist from Vlahovic. The final goal came in the 85th minute when **Nicolas Gonzalez**, returning from injury, sealed the win with a composed finish.

Key Match Facts:- Dusan Vlahovic (43′) – scored the opening goal for Juventus.
Teun Koopmeiners (50′) – extended the lead with a brilliant free-kick.
Francisco Conceição (75′) – added a third goal.
Nicolas Gonzalez (85′) – sealed the win with a final goal.

Next Match: Juventus vs Empoli
Juventus will face Empoli in the Coppa Italia quarter-finals as they aim to continue their strong run in the competition.
